Move to Canada or not

Hi all,
I know there are some people on this forum from Canada and lot from the US. I need some help from you to make some very important decisions in life and me and my husband are totally confused about it, so I decided to post our confusion here to hear what you would have done in this situation.

We are from India and my husband works in the US on a H1B visa which is a non immigrant visa. Our Green Card in US has been filed and it will probably take another 1.5 -2 years to get it.
Meanwhile we applied for Permanent Residency in Canada and in January 2005 we got Canadian Permanent Residency equivalent to Green Card in the US.
At the same time in December 2004 I got diagnosed with stage 3C BC with a 9 cm large tomor and 11/21 nodes positive. I got AC/T and Herceptin for 2 years and I am currently on Aromasin and Zoladex plus a long list of supplements. My husband is curently debating with the insurance company to get me at least 6 months of Tykerb as a monotherapy.

Now we just came to know that if we do not move to Canada by January 2008 then we will loose out Canadian Permanent Residency. So we both have been thinking what to do.
What we are not sure is to how to compare the medical systems in Canada and US. My husbands company is ready to move him to Canada and he can work from Toronto.

In Canada can you buy Tykerb out of you pocket if you want to have it as a monotherapy.
How is it with Aromasin and Zoladex? We have also heard that first 3 months we will not recieve any medical coverage from the Government and we will have a Private insurance. Will we be able to get aromasin and zoladex thru them?

How is the medical system of Canada as compared to the US?
Generallly how is the life in Canada. Please comment.
